ECIA - EIA-364-51
TP-51B Ice Resistance Test Procedure for Electrical Connectors

scope:
This standard establishes test methods to determine the ability of mated electrical connectors to resist the effects of ice build-up due to water splashing or brief immersion in water, where water is free to drain off of the connector surfaces.
